Overview

Our client is a long-established Sheffield business operating within the construction sector with over 40 years of success across commercial and residential markets. With consistent growth and a reputation for looking after their people, they are now seeking a Company Accountant to act as the No.2 in Finance, supporting the Finance Lead and wider leadership team.

This is a pivotal role within a tight-knit finance function, where you’ll oversee day-to-day financial operations across multiple trading entities and the holding company. Working closely with the Finance No.1, you’ll be positioned as their long-term successor, offering a clear pathway to step into the top finance role over the next 4–5 years.

The Role

A broad, hands-on position with responsibility for key financial processes and operational oversight, including:

  • Managing weekly payroll and subcontractor payments
  • Overseeing credit control, customer contact, issuing statements, and chasing retentions
  • Maintaining sales and purchase ledgers
  • Stock booking, costing, and cashflow monitoring
  • Preparing daily cash sheets for directors
  • Monthly PAYE, CIS returns, reconciliations
  • Supporting quarterly management accounts and year-end audit preparation
  • Acting as deputy to the Finance Lead, covering essential duties during holiday periods

About You

We’re looking for a commercially minded finance professional who thrives in a broad SME environment:

  • Experience as a Company Accountant, Assistant Accountant, or Management Accountant within a small finance team
  • Strong IT and accounting technical skills
  • Confident communicator, able to liaise with customers, suppliers, and internal teams
  • Highly organised, proactive, and adaptable
  • Background in credit control, payroll, or general accounts is beneficial
  • AAT qualification helpful but not essential — qualified by experience welcomed
  • Construction sector experience advantageous but not required

Why This Role Stands Out

  • Join a stable, profitable, long-standing Sheffield business
  • Work directly with senior leadership and gain exposure across the group
  • Clear progression pathway to Finance No.1 role
  • Annual profit share bonus paid consistently for the last 10 years
  • Supportive, friendly culture with exceptionally low staff turnover
  • Varied workload — no two days look the same

Hours: 8:30am–5pm
